ATLANTA, Ga. (Atlanta News First) — Two people were hurt after a car crashed into the side of a DeKalb County home overnight, police said.
Offices were called to Parkwood Trace, a residential street in unincorporated Stone Mountain, at around 9:30 p.m. on Friday. The car’s driver and passenger were both taken to the hospital, the driver with serious injuries.
Police believe the car was driving on Cavan Drive, a dead-end road, when it went down a steep slope, tearing through the woodline and crashing into the house through the backyard. Nobody inside the home was hurt.
Officers aren’t sure what led to the accident. The investigation is ongoing.
